Market Overview
The Turkey Ice Cream Market reached a size of USD 689.24 Million in 2024 and is projected to grow to USD 900.09 Million by 2033. The market is expected to grow at a CAGR of 3.01% during the forecast period 2025-2033. Growth is driven by consumer demand for innovative flavors, artisanal textures, and plant-based products, alongside the continued popularity of traditional varieties. Retail and foodservice channels are expanding with a focus on clean-label ingredients and appealing product formats.

Market Growth Factors
The Turkey ice cream market is deeply influenced by the traditional and cultural appeal of products such as dondurma, originating from KahramanmaraÅŸ. Known for its chewy texture and resistance to melting, dondurma is not only consumed as a dessert but serves as a cultural symbol. This tradition, often accompanied by street vendor performances, continues to drive strong domestic and tourist demand, fostering brand loyalty and maintaining the popularity of traditional ice cream varieties across Turkey.
Consumer preferences are evolving with burgeoning interest in flavor innovation and premium offerings. Brands are introducing unique flavors like Turkish coffee, baklava, tahini, and exotic fruits, which excite consumers and enhance market differentiation. The rise of low-sugar, gelato, and artisanal ice creams caters especially to young, quality-conscious urban consumers. Seasonal launches and limited editions boost repeat purchases and offer consumers personalized, gourmet experiences, reinforcing growth in a competitive market.
Health awareness is significantly impacting product development in the Turkey ice cream market. Consumers increasingly seek plant-based alternatives, reduced-sugar options, and ice creams without artificial additives. Producers have responded by launching vegan ice creams made from almond, soy, or coconut milk, alongside functional variants containing proteins or probiotics. Additionally, lactose-free and gluten-free variants meet dietary restrictions, appealing primarily to younger, urban consumers seeking guilt-free indulgence. Marketing strategies emphasizing clean-label and nutritional benefits are vital to success in this expanding segment.
